2.
Can you guarantee that my migration application will be approved?
NO. The Migration Agents Code of Conduct strictly prohibits us
from providing you the guarantee that a migration application will
succeed, and any application, no matter how strong on
paper, can be refused by DIAC. Some of the criteria for the visa
are beyond our control (eg health and character). However it is our
policy not to accept cases that we do not believe will meet or
exceed the minimum requirements. We will endeavour to ensure that your
application is presented in the best possible way. To date we have had a
100% success rate.

5.
Would I be eligible to migrate even if my qualifications and work
experience are in different fields?
Yes it is possible, but
in most cases, you will get additional points for work experience,
only if you have work experience in the same field as your
occupation (for which you have been assessed) or in a closely
related field.
6.
Do I need formal qualifications to apply for skilled
migration?
In most cases, applicants will need formal qualifications in order
to pass skills assessment. In particular, for 40 or 50-point
occupations, you will definitely need to hold formal tertiary
qualifications to qualify for skills assessment. However, formal
qualifications are not necessarily required for many 60-point occupations
in the Trades and IT Professional fields.

9. How long does it take to get the
visa?
The waiting period mainly depends on the type of visa
class you are applying under. For skilled visas applications for
occupations in demand the process can take 9-14 months and other
occupations between 12-18months.

12. Who would be eligible to apply under
the business and investment immigration visas?
Business owners and chief executives of a company may be eligible
for business immigration. Usually, there is a two stage process
involved , whereby if successful a provisional visa is granted for 4
years. Thereafter, you may apply for permanent residency if certain
requirements are met. Please complete the business
skills assessment form for an initial assessment.
13. Once my visa is approved, how long
before I must move downunder?
A permanent residence visa has a date by which your first entry
must be made. This is usually within a year from the date of
your police and medical certificates. This initial entry validates
your visa. Once validated you have a period of 5 years (counted
from date visa granted) to arrive and settle in Australia.
